Here's the breakdown of my situation:

Line 1: Samsung Galaxy S4; UDP; Upgrade eligible
Line 2: iPhone 5; TDP; Upgrade eligible
Line 3: Dumbphone; No DP; Upgrade eligible
Line 4: Dumbphone; No DP; Not upgrade eligible

So just to keep everyone updated and informed, I went through a bit of a panic after I heard about the 8/13 subsidized phone hammer dropping so I went ahead and tried to order an SGS6 off of BB to replace my SGS4. Something was wrong with Best Buy's website and I couldn't order the phone using the Line 3 upgrade so I went ahead and ordered it off of VZW's website. This proved to be a mistake, the phone was $50 more expensive but came with the hassle of a $50 MIR (so the net was the same) and VZW charged a $40 activation fee which BB didn't. The next day BB's website was working again and I transferred my Line 1 upgrade to Line 4 and purchased an SGS6 through BB's website with no issues. I called VZW to cancel my original order but it had already shipped. I should've just refused the shipment when it came but I was out of town and my wife went ahead and signed for it.

I had to call VZW to tell that that I never even touched the phone and they need to waive the restocking fee of $35. They've agreed to and it should get credited on my next billing cycle.

My new SGS6 arrived from BB with no issues. I was debating whether or not to keep it since my SGS4 still runs like a champ but shiny new electronics fever took over and I decided to go with it. I took the phone out, removed the SIM card, threw it aside, and sat around waiting since I couldn't use the phone without a SIM. Next day I took the phone to a VAR near my house. I made up a story that the SGS6 was for my dad but he didn't like it so he took my SGS4, I gave him the nano-SIM with a SIM adapter and now I need a new nano-SIM. The guy bought the story and proceeded to get me a new nano-SIM. He told me it was going to be a $25 charge for a new SIM...wtf?!?! I figured $25 was a small price to pay to keep my UDP BUT I said to him that corporate stores don't charge anything and if there was anything he could do to help me out. He said he could do something.

In the end he charged me nothing, popped the new SIM in, setup the phone and I was off and running. I don't even see the pending activation on my account!
